Motion Compensation for Compressive Sensing SAR Imaging |

Abstract Because of its compressed sampling property, Compressive Sensing (CS) has wide application to high resolution imaging. But as a parametric imaging method, CS based imaging methods are sensitive to position error. Position error may cause defocusing, range migration, or even can not imaging. This paper concerns the analysis and compensation of trajectory deviations in airborne spotlight Synthetic Aperture Radar (SAR). A motion compensated CS SAR imaging scheme is proposed based on the sensor measured data. An additional item is introduced into the sparse matrix to achieve the compensation of space invariant motion error. This method can not only get enough information for imaging using few measure position and data, but also reduce the affection of motion error on image quality, achieve high resolution imaging.
